  • Distilled Water vs. Tap Water: Why Choose Purity for Your Solutions?
    There are several reasons why distilled water is preferred over tap water for preparing solutions:

    1. Purity: Distilled water undergoes a process called distillation, which involves boiling water and collecting the pure water vapor that evaporates. This process removes impurities such as minerals, salts, organic matter, and microorganisms that may be present in tap water. Distilled water is therefore purer and more consistent in composition compared to tap water.

    2. Avoidance of Reactions: Impurities in tap water, such as minerals and ions, can react with the substances being dissolved and alter the properties or concentration of the desired solution. Distilled water is less likely to introduce unwanted reactions or interferences due to its high purity.

    3. Accurate Measurements: When preparing solutions, accurate measurements are crucial. Impurities in tap water can affect the accuracy of measurements by altering the volume or weight of the solution. Distilled water ensures that the measurements are more precise and reliable.

    4. Suitability for Sensitive Applications: Distilled water is essential in applications where high purity is required, such as in pharmaceutical manufacturing, laboratory experiments, medical procedures, and cosmetic formulations. Tap water may contain contaminants or microorganisms that could compromise the quality or safety of the solution.

    5. Longer Shelf Life: Solutions prepared with distilled water tend to have a longer shelf life compared to those made with tap water. Impurities in tap water can accelerate the degradation of solutions over time, whereas distilled water helps maintain the stability and integrity of the prepared solutions.

    6. Consistency: Distilled water has a consistent composition, which is important when preparing solutions that require reproducibility and standardization. Tap water quality can vary depending on the source and location, making it less reliable for consistent results.

    7. Prevention of Scale Buildup: Minerals present in tap water can cause scale buildup in laboratory glassware and equipment over time. Distilled water helps prevent scale formation, making it suitable for long-term use in laboratory settings.

    While tap water may be suitable for certain general purposes, distilled water is the preferred choice for preparing solutions due to its purity, consistency, and reliability. It minimizes the risk of contamination or interference, ensuring accurate and reproducible results.
